[edit]Verb
[edit]look it (third-person singular simple present looks it, present participle looking it, simple past and past participle looked it)
- (intransitive) To resemble in appearance; to look like.
- She is six months pregnant and looking it.
- 2025 February 19, Paul Clifton, “I am absolutely committed to reforming the railway”, in RAIL, number 1029, page 39:
- At 71 (he really does not look it), he still has the fire in his belly for such a challenge.
